Rain drummed on the van roof while Molly unfolded a blueprint across the dashboard. It was actually a takeaway menu, but the grease stain resembled the party hall well enough. At midnight, the community center glowed beneath a banner reading HAPPY BIRTHDAY, TREVOR! Balloons bobbed behind the windows, and a cardboard dragon guarded the entrance with an expression of permanent disappointment. Bill adjusted his tiny black mask. “Are we sure this is a heist?” “It has a target, security, and a getaway vehicle,” Molly said. “That is the textbook definition.” “Our getaway vehicle is a borrowed ice-cream van.” “Exactly. Nobody suspects ice cream.” “They suspect ice cream when it’s raining.” Molly pointed to the side door. “We enter through the kitchen, cross the corridor, and reach the presents before the magician’s second act.” Bill studied the map. “What’s the magician’s first act?” “Making a rabbit disappear.” “And the second?” “Making a balloon poodle.” “That doesn’t sound dangerous.” “Neither does a rabbit until you’re hiding from it in a cupboard.” They slipped from the van wearing matching yellow raincoats and carrying a crate labeled EMERGENCY PUDDING. The label was Molly’s idea. Bill had wanted “Highly Classified Cake,” but Molly said cakes attracted questions. The kitchen door yielded to a bent spoon. Inside, three bakers were arguing over a mountain of cupcakes. One glanced up. “Delivery?” he asked. “Pudding emergency,” Molly replied. The baker nodded solemnly and returned to the argument. They moved through the corridor, past a table where children had abandoned paper crowns, plastic swords, and one alarming number of raisins. At the end stood the present table, buried under brightly wrapped boxes. Bill’s eyes widened. “That’s a fortune.” “It’s mostly socks and educational toys.” “Fortunes come in many forms.” A shriek erupted from the party room. The magician had begun his second act. A balloon animal squealed as he twisted it into shape. Molly opened the emergency crate. Inside were two oven mitts, a rubber chicken, and a small hand vacuum. “Why the chicken?” Bill whispered. “Diversion.” She squeezed it. The chicken produced a noise like a goose being audited. Every adult turned toward the kitchen. Bill grabbed the nearest presents, while Molly swept smaller packages into a laundry sack. They worked with impressive speed until a little girl in a glittery crown appeared beside them. “What are you doing?” she asked. Bill froze. “We’re… present inspectors.” “Are you stealing them?” Molly leaned closer. “Temporarily relocating them for safety.” The girl considered this. “Can I come?” “No,” Molly said. “Yes,” Bill said. Molly glared at him. The girl pointed toward the window. “The real thieves are leaving through the front.” Molly and Bill spun around. Two adults were sprinting away with the largest boxes, pursued by a furious clown. Bill dropped the sack. “We’ve been robbed.” “By professionals,” Molly said. The birthday boy charged into the corridor. “Those are my presents!” Molly grabbed Bill’s arm. “New plan. We steal them back.” “Does that still make us thieves?” “Absolutely.” They raced into the rain, followed by the glitter-crowned girl, the clown, and six children wielding plastic swords. Behind them, the cardboard dragon toppled over, apparently unwilling to miss the adventure.
